0
点赞
收藏
分享

微信扫一扫

Python作图的好处

Greatiga 2023-07-19 阅读 65

Python作图的好处

作图是数据分析和可视化的重要工具之一,在Python中使用各种库可以轻松实现各种作图功能。本文将介绍Python作图的好处以及实现作图的步骤和对应的代码示例。

Python作图的好处

  1. 丰富的图形库:Python拥有众多的图形库,如Matplotlib、Seaborn、Plotly等,可以绘制各种类型的图表,从简单的折线图和柱状图到复杂的热力图和3D图形,满足不同需求。
  2. 易于使用:Python作图库提供了简单易懂的API和丰富的文档,即使是初学者也能快速上手,实现各种图表的绘制和定制。
  3. 强大的可视化能力:通过作图,可以直观地展示数据的规律和趋势,帮助我们更好地理解数据,发现隐藏在数据背后的信息,支持决策和分析工作。
  4. 与数据分析的无缝集成:Python作图库可以与其他数据分析库(如Pandas和NumPy)无缝集成,通过简单的代码就能将数据可视化,实现数据分析的全流程。

实现作图的步骤

下面是实现作图的一般步骤,每个步骤后面都会给出示例代码和代码的注释。

步骤 描述 代码示例
1 导入相关库 import matplotlib.pyplot as plt
2 准备数据 x = [1, 2, 3, 4, 5]<br>y = [10, 20, 15, 25, 30]
3 创建图表 plt.figure()
4 绘制图形 plt.plot(x, y, label='line')
5 添加标题 plt.title('Line Chart')
6 添加坐标轴标签 plt.xlabel('X')<br>plt.ylabel('Y')
7 添加图例 plt.legend()
8 显示图形 plt.show()

代码解释

  1. 在第1步中,我们导入了matplotlib.pyplot库,它是Python中常用的绘图库。
  2. 在第2步中,我们准备了两个列表xy,分别代表横坐标和纵坐标的数据。
  3. 在第3步中,我们创建了一个新的图表对象。
  4. 在第4步中,我们使用plot函数绘制了一条折线图,传入了xy作为参数,并设置了一个图例label
  5. 在第5和第6步中,我们分别为图表添加了标题和坐标轴标签。
  6. 在第7步中,我们添加了图例,让图表更易于理解。
  7. 在第8步中,我们使用show函数显示图形。

以上是一个简单的示例,实际使用中可以根据需要进行更多的定制和调整。

总结

Python作图提供了丰富的图形库和易于使用的API,通过几行简单的代码就能实现各种图表的绘制和定制。作图不仅能够直观地展示数据,还能与其他数据分析库无缝集成,为数据分析和决策提供有力支持。希望本文的介绍能够帮助你快速上手Python作图,享受数据可视化的乐趣。

举报

相关推荐

0 条评论